A mosquito bite usually causes only a minor inflammation in the area of the bite. If the area seems to be getting larger or changing color, it may be appropriate to seek a professional. If it remains small, a small dab of hydro-cortisone cream (available over the counter) may lessen the redness, but be careful not to put it in your mouth or eyes and follow directions and warnings on the label.
